Indiana Beach & Christmas Assistance

Family Focus at Indiana Beach and Christmas Assistance have been discontinued for 2008 -

 
As you may be aware, Hemophilia of Indiana offers numerous programs and services to those affected by bleeding disorders and their families across Indiana.  Funding for these activities is provided through the generous contributions of individual and corporate sponsors as well as through special events and grant writing.  This means depending upon the amount of funding received, HII staff and board members have to decide when to add or discontinue various programs.  As many of you know in 2006, HII with help from the IHTC and other supporters, instituted the HII Dental Insurance Program, which now provides dental insurance coverage to more than 340 community members.

Due to limited funding HII has decided to direct our funds to those programs that are more wide reaching within the community, such as the HII Dental Insurance Program, emergency financial assistance, medic alert identification and community education events, such as our annual meeting.  This meant that we had to eliminate some programs, such as the Family Focus event and limit others, such as our Christmas Assistance program. 

For the past 7 years, Hemophilia of Indiana has provided holiday assistance to families in need, helping more than 25 families each year.  This year, rather than trying to provide this type of assistance ourselves we will be working to identify other agencies across the state who have been established for this purpose and will then connect those in need with these agencies.
